期刊文献+
共找到3篇文章
< 1 >
每页显示 20 50 100
VxWorks系统下CAN驱动的设计与优化 被引量:3
1
作者 尹加豹 朱涛 崔凯华 《计算机工程》 CAS CSCD 北大核心 2020年第3期192-197,共6页
为在VxWorks系统下实现龙芯3A3000主板的控制器局域网(CAN)总线通信,采用SJA1000T设计基于PCI总线的8通道CAN通信板,并提出相应的驱动设计和优化方案。对龙芯3A3000处理器的驱动进行优化,在发送数据时禁用CAN而使用查询方式发送,在接收... 为在VxWorks系统下实现龙芯3A3000主板的控制器局域网(CAN)总线通信,采用SJA1000T设计基于PCI总线的8通道CAN通信板,并提出相应的驱动设计和优化方案。对龙芯3A3000处理器的驱动进行优化,在发送数据时禁用CAN而使用查询方式发送,在接收数据时中断服务程序对所有通道进行遍历查询,以提高中断利用率,在创建设备函数时根据PCI总线信息识别每个CAN通信板,以确保系统中不同CAN通道拥有唯一的通道号。实验结果表明,该驱动方案运行稳定,数据传输安全可靠,经优化后能够有效降低CAN通信板的中断次数,提高CAN总线的通信速率,避免多板环境下故障板卡干扰正常板卡,提高了系统的健壮性。 展开更多
关键词 VXWORKS系统 控制器局域网总线 SJA1000T控制器 龙芯3A 驱动设计
下载PDF
基于VxWorks的SMP技术研究 被引量:1
2
作者 尹加豹 王红敏 《计算机光盘软件与应用》 2013年第15期81-83,86,共4页
嵌入式操作系统VxWorks正从单核结构向多核结构过渡,SMP是其中必不可少的一个阶段,本文研究VxWorks SMP内核的工作机制,概述了SMP和VxWorksSMP编程,分析了VxWorks SMP任务调度模块及相关数据结构,并根据VxWorks SMP中断管理机制设计了一... 嵌入式操作系统VxWorks正从单核结构向多核结构过渡,SMP是其中必不可少的一个阶段,本文研究VxWorks SMP内核的工作机制,概述了SMP和VxWorksSMP编程,分析了VxWorks SMP任务调度模块及相关数据结构,并根据VxWorks SMP中断管理机制设计了一种CPU中断处理负载均衡算法。由于嵌入式硬件平台与嵌入式系统软件发展不平衡,研究支持SMP的嵌入式操作系统具有一定的现实意义和理论意义。 展开更多
关键词 VXWORKS SMP 多核
下载PDF
VxWorks5.5下电子盘DMA驱动程序设计与实现
3
作者 尹加豹 《电子技术应用》 北大核心 2016年第11期40-43,共4页
在嵌入式实时操作系统中,经常需要实时读写硬盘数据,为了提高VxWorks5.5系统下IDE电子盘读写速度,提出了一种基于ICH7-M南桥芯片的DMA模式驱动软件的设计方法。该方法采用风河公司提供的磁盘驱动程序框架,设计了新的读写接口函数,新驱... 在嵌入式实时操作系统中,经常需要实时读写硬盘数据,为了提高VxWorks5.5系统下IDE电子盘读写速度,提出了一种基于ICH7-M南桥芯片的DMA模式驱动软件的设计方法。该方法采用风河公司提供的磁盘驱动程序框架,设计了新的读写接口函数,新驱动遵循ATA-6接口协议并采用UDMA2传输模式,可使电子盘读写速度提高十余倍。应用结果表明,该方法运行稳定,系统的实时性提高,充分发挥了电子盘性能。 展开更多
关键词 VxWorks5.5 DMA 电子盘 驱动
下载PDF
上一页 1 下一页 到第
使用帮助 返回顶部